Advertising is an extremely important part of any poker players game at the mid stakes or higher (at the low stakes it is useless as mostly the players are too weak to notice it, and/or respond to it).
It is especially important for tight players, as the fact that they are playing very few hands indicates that they are usually strong, which makes getting paid off on your big hands much harder. Because of this, it is often wise to play the occasional junk hand in an aggressive manner if you are a very tight player - simply for the sake of showing a bad hand that you have bluffed with/shown down.
If you are a looser player, then your playing style has it's own built in advertising - you simply cannot always have the hand because you are playing so many. Here, a sort of reverse advertising becomes useful, where it is worth trying to show down your monsters, even at the expense of winning a few extra bets. If the table has seen you showdown some big hands, they will start to respect your raises too much and your loose style will pick up many more pots than it otherwise might have. Here we can clearly see that giving up a few extra bets earlier can win many more later.
The greatest use of advertising is that it can be a great way to initiate changing gears. Say you have been playing quite tight and you win a big pot with a big pair. This is often a great time to start raising a lot of hands, as your opponents will be worried about the fact that they saw you have the goods. After a while, they will start to notice that you are rasing lots of hands, and may very well call you down and see that you have been raising junk. Obviously after this you quickly return to the tight style, and let your opponents new found curiosity pay the dividends on your big hands.
Just like with advertising in the real world, the human brain only needs a surprisingly small push to start thinking about something in a certain way. You really only need to throw in the occasional bit of strange play to quickly convince opponents that you play in a ceratin way. By thinking about not only how your opponents are playing, but also how they think you are, you can utilise advertising to really push up your profits.
